Fred Bell

Director, Palm Springs Air Museum

Fred works with and manages the museum from attracting visitors to flight operations. He is the host of Warbird Wednesdays, and a historian and preservationist of American aviation history. A proud ‘aviation aficionado', Fred’s family included a couple of WWII aviators that helped spark his interest in the subject. His career and love for aviation history led him to the Palm Springs Air Museum.
